The day before the Hubertus Hunt, this year's CrossCountry tournament was held in light drizzle, but otherwise mild conditions. It was actually close to the worst weather the tournament has experienced in the years it has existed.
The crosscountry is the greenkeepers' thanks for this season. Not as vicious as at many other clubs where they play "the greenkeeper's revenge". At the Hermitage it is only a walk across the rough. 12 holes are played as a scramble across the regular holes and often using old, abandoned tees from the course's long history.
The best selling point of the match is that the restaurant serves small treats and vin chaud on the 9th tee of the course. The players come here several times and it is popular.
